In Colorado in the year 1979, the most popular baby girl name was Jennifer, with 818 babies given that name. The next four most popular names were Melissa (440), Amanda (405), Jessica (398), and Sarah (385). These names were all very popular choices for parents of baby girls in Colorado during that year.

In Colorado, 1979, Michael was the most popular baby boy name with 867 babies given that name. Christopher came in second with 691 babies, followed closely by Jason with 654 babies. David was the fourth most popular name with 603 babies, and Joshua rounded out the top five with 599 babies given that name.
The name Michael means "Who is like God?" in Hebrew. It is a biblical name that is often associated with the archangel Michael, who is considered to be a protector and warrior in many religious traditions. The name has been popular throughout history and is still commonly used today.
The name Christopher means "bearer of Christ" or "Christ-bearer."
The name Jason is of Greek origin and means "healer" or "to heal".
The name David is of Hebrew origin and means "beloved" or "friend". It is a popular name in many cultures and religions, including Judaism, Christianity, and Islam. In the Bible, David was the second king of Israel and is known for his bravery, leadership, and devotion to God. People with the name David are often described as confident, charismatic, and loyal.
The name Joshua means "God is salvation" or "Yahweh is salvation" in Hebrew. It is a biblical name and was the name of one of the twelve spies sent by Moses into Canaan. Joshua later became the successor to Moses and led the Israelites into the Promised Land.

The name Andrew means "manly" or "warrior" and is of Greek origin. It is derived from the Greek name Andreas, which comes from the word "andrós" meaning "man". Andrew is a popular name in many English-speaking countries and is often used in Christian traditions due to the apostle Andrew being one of the twelve disciples of Jesus Christ.
The name Eric is of Scandinavian origin and means "eternal ruler" or "ruler of all". It is a popular name in many countries and cultures.
The name Timothy is of Greek origin and means "honoring God" or "one who honors God". It is derived from the Greek name Timotheos, which is a combination of the words "timao" meaning to honor and "theos" meaning God.
